摘  要:针对城市污水厂二级出水用于地下回灌的两种深度处理工艺 ,确定了达到消毒要求的加氯量 ,并且研究了加氯消毒对有关水质参数DOC、AOX、CHCl3、CCl4 、UV2 54 等的影响。研究发现 ,有效氯投加量在 8mg L左右时 ,水中细菌总数与总大肠菌群数均能达到我国饮用水卫生标准。加氯后水的DOC值变化不大 ,AOX值则有较明显的增大 ,CHCl3浓度略有增加 ,CCl4 基本维持在加氯前的水平 ,UV2 54 值也较加氯前有所增大。研究结果还表明 ,粒状活性炭处理工艺在污水深度处理流程中对去除消毒副产物 (AOX)s: To enable the secondary effluentt to be used for groundwater recharge, chlorine dosages for two advanced treatment processes were determined to meet the disinfection requirement. The effects of chlorination on organic parameters such as DOC , AOX , CHCl 3, CCl 4, UV 254 were also studied. The results show that an available chlorine dosage of about 8 mg/L can make the total count of bacteria and the total coliforms meet the national sanitation standard for drinking water. After disinfection with chlorine, DOC changes very little, AOX increases significantly, CHCl 3 increases a little, CCl 4 almost does not change, and UV 254 also increases. The result also shows that the granular activated carbon plays a very important role in the removal of disinfection by-product - AOX and its precursors.
